I spent a week in Trier, so of course we met Bitburger. As you know, if you have spent a time in Trier, there is not much to do... after a few days I'm pretty sure I exhausted most of the activities. So, of course, I have my group to drink and hang in the best looking pub of the kind. I went twice to Bitburger, once for dinner and once for drinks. I was pleasantly surprised by the tomatoes basil soup. Trier was cool because I was used to Texas weather at the time, so I wanted something warm. The soup was velvety and thick... most tomato soups have a very runny consistency, but this thicker version was just the ticket. I can say they use fresh tomatoes and cream that made the whole difference. I used all my bread for diving and asked for more! And I was tried to lick the bowl clean. The naughty sparrow I had was decent - not the best I had but had a beautiful texture and was hot. The salad I ordered was quite generic, but had a nice oil and vinegar. The service was slow, but since I wasn't in a hurry, I didn't mind. Maybe not the best place for a quick meal, but the warm and slightly dark atmosphere makes it a great place to eat and drink with friends.
